Mineral Spa at Peppers Springs Retreat celebrates three wins at Australasian Spa Awards
Victorian operators netted a total of five awards at the recent Australasian Spa Association (ASpa) Spas of Excellence awards which recognise excellence in service delivery in the spa, health and wellness industry.
Mineral Spa at Peppers Spring Retreat dominated the wins for Victoria, taking three highly coveted awards of Best Hotel Spa, Best Day Spa (Rural) and the Spa Life magazine’s Readers Choice Award for Best Destination Spa and reinforcing Hepburn Springs and the Daylesford Macedon Ranges region as Australia’s leading spa tourism destination.
The awards add to a long list of accolades for Mineral Spa, one of Hepburn Springs’ most renowned destination spas, known for its contemporary, environment, holistic approach and professionalism of their staff.
Other Victoria operators that won awards on the night include: Spa Dreamtime, located at the St Kilda Sea Baths, which won Best Day Spa (Urban) 2008; and Peace and Quiet, a wellbeing centre in Ballarat which won Employer of Choice 2008
